One of the most iconic PlayStation games of all time is “Final Fantasy VII.” Released in 1997 for the original PlayStation, the game introduced players to Cloud eu9 malaysia Strife and his quest to save the world from the malevolent corporation, Shinra, and the villainous Sephiroth. “Final Fantasy VII” was revolutionary for its time, combining stunning visuals, an unforgettable soundtrack, and an intricate story that still resonates with fans today. The game’s deep, turn-based combat system and memorable characters set a high bar for RPGs and helped establish the PlayStation as the premier platform for gaming. For gamers seeking a nostalgic journey, the recent “Final Fantasy VII Remake” offers a modernized version of the classic, combining the original’s core story with updated gameplay and visuals, making it a perfect way to experience the magic of the game once again.

Another beloved PlayStation classic is “Crash Bandicoot,” the platformer that introduced players to the mischievous marsupial, Crash. Released in 1996 for 1xbet malaysia the PlayStation, “Crash Bandicoot” was a groundbreaking 3D platformer that offered tight controls, challenging levels, and a charming cast of characters. The game’s innovative design, with its combination of linear platforming and exploration, helped define the 3D platformer genre. The game spawned multiple sequels, and the “Crash Bandicoot N. Sane Trilogy” remaster collection brings these classic games to modern consoles with updated graphics, making it easy for nostalgic gamers to revisit the challenging levels and iconic moments of the original trilogy.

In the realm of racing games, “Gran Turismo” helped define the genre on PlayStation, offering realistic driving physics and an incredible selection of cars. The original “Gran Turismo,” winbox malaysia released in 1997, allowed players to experience the thrill of high-speed racing with a level of realism that had never been seen before in a console game. The “Gran Turismo” series would go on to become one of the best-selling video game franchises of all time, and the “Gran Turismo 7” release on PlayStation 5 continues to offer stunning graphics and realistic driving mechanics. For nostalgic racing fans, the ability to revisit the “Gran Turismo” games offers a perfect blend of classic racing excitement and modern improvements.
